Subject: Gatehouse rate limiter — new per-team quotas live in prod

Team,

The Gatehouse internal API gateway now enforces per-team quotas instead of the old global bucket. Limits are read from the Quillfig config service at startup; changes need a gateway restart until hot-reload ships. Overages return 429 with a retry-after header. Future maintainers: the quota logic lives in the limiter module, not middleware. This rollout corresponds to the build token below.

pipeline stamp: htk9_ce63042d9

Welcome to the GateTally team. GateTally is the turnstile counter service that tracks entry counts for every gate at Harrowfield Stadium venues running our hardware. Counts are aggregated per minute and pushed to the capacity dashboard, which operations staff use to make gate-closure decisions on match days. New team members should start by reading the ingestion pipeline overview and the sensor calibration guide before touching production data. The full architecture notes, runbooks, and on-call rotation details live on our internal wiki page.

runbook for tafof-yawif: https://confluence.tolvaqsys.internal/display/display/browse/pages/7be3

Handover — Studio Bookings

Hey Priya,

Taking over the desk while I'm out? Main thing is the recording studio on Level 3 — the training video crew from Marlow & Fenn are in most mornings this week. They'll ask you to buzz them up; that's fine, they're on the approved list. Keep the corridor quiet when the red lamp's on, and don't let anyone book the studio past 4pm (cleaners need it). If they get locked out, the studio keypad takes the code below.

Thanks!
Tomas

door code, yagap-bahof: bdg-O-05

Handover: Tumblecube locker access flow

Welcome aboard. The access flow works like this: a resident scans a code at the locker bank, our Tumblecube service validates the reservation, then issues a one-time unlock signal to the hardware controller. Watch the retry path — the controller acks slowly under load, and premature retries can double-unlock. The service currently runs with these configuration values.

deployment values, yahag-tawef:
ZORWYN_HOST=zorwyn.tolvaqlabs.internal
ZORWYN_PORT=9300